Thyroid Awareness

Understanding thyroid health can save lives.

Our thyroid awareness work focuses on helping individuals and families in Nigeria understand thyroid symptoms, the importance of early testing, and the value of timely medical attention.

The thyroid is a small gland in the neck that plays an important role in regulating metabolism, energy level, body temperature, and several essential body functions.

Many thyroid conditions go unnoticed because their symptoms are often mistaken for stress, fatigue, hormonal changes, or everyday health struggles. This is why awareness and early attention matter.

Through education and community sensitization, we aim to help more people recognize the warning signs early and seek proper medical care.

Common Warning Signs

  • • Unexplained weight gain or weight loss
  • • Constant tiredness or unusual weakness
  • • Swelling or discomfort around the neck
  • • Fast or unusually slow heartbeat
  • • Mood changes, anxiety, or depression
  • • Sensitivity to cold or heat

Why Awareness Matters

Many people live with thyroid-related symptoms for long periods without knowing the cause. Awareness helps people take action early.

Early Detection

Early testing and proper diagnosis can improve quality of life and help reduce avoidable complications.

Community Education

Public sensitization empowers families and communities with practical knowledge about thyroid symptoms and care.

These moments reflect the foundation’s work across stakeholder engagement, community sensitisation, World Thyroid Day awareness, and the official foundation launch activities in Lafia, Nasarawa State.

Stakeholders Engagement

February 2025

The foundation began its thyroid awareness campaign with a stakeholders engagement in Lafia, Nasarawa State, bringing together community leaders, religious leaders, health workers, and representatives of the Ministry of Health to share the mission and build local support.

Foundation Launch

25–27 May 2025

The foundation launch was a three-day program that included the World Thyroid Walk on 25/05/2025, school sandals distribution on 26/05/2025 at TA'AL Model Primary School and Tudun Gwandara Primary School, and the official foundation launch on 27/05/2025.
